A group of around 20 combatants entered the village at around four Friday afternoon and thrashed around half-a-dozen youths, including Hemanta Buda Magar, Dil Bahadur Tarami and Amar Gharti. [break]
The combatants attacked the youths for retaliating against a combatant who misbehaved with a woman Thursday midnight.
Similarly, the locals had tied another combatant, who had misbehaved with a woman in Kailashpur Wednesday night, and handed him over to the camp.
“One Pahad from the Talband Camp had misbehaved with my aunt who lives at Balidan Bazaar near the camp Wednesday night.
They beat me as I had retaliated that night,” said Buda Magar who has sustained head and neck injuries. Buda Magar said Pahad had tried to misbehave with another woman in Indrapur that evening.
The locals have protested the attack demanding action against the combatants. Locals obstructed three vehicles going to the Maoist camp Friday evening.
The camp authorities, however, claimed that it was just a minor scuffle between local youths and a couple of combatants and efforts are on to settle the matter locally.
